Mr. and Mrs. Gibbs had two children after the birth of Hubert, Carrol Jackson Gibbs, born 1940, and Donald Douglas. The simple tombstone made of concrete with H. L. Gibbs and the date scribed on it was made by Carrol Jackson Gibbs when he was twelve years old. Pauline, born April 26, 1915, was a daughter of Carrol Newton Reavis and Nancy Elizabeth Waggoner. Carrol Newton was a son of George Washington and Lucy Ann Marshall. Julious was son of Hugh Jackson and Gracie Lee (Church) Gibbs who married July 12, 1913 in Madison Co. Alabama. Julious was born Dec. 5, 1915, in Chickamauga, Georgia. He died May 6, 1974. He is buried in Maple Hill Cemetery. Pauline died in 1997. Sources: Pauline Gibbs (Mrs. Julious). Research by Elmo Reavis, Family Files, Heritage Room, Huntsville Public Library. Marriage record (Julious), Vol. 60, p. 359. Marriage record (Hugh), Vol. 38, p. 492. GIBSON, MARIE CORRELLI, APR. 13, 1912 - SEPT. 26, 1912 DAUGHTER OF ROYDON AND HATTIE GIBSON. (ROW 26) Roydon Gibson and Hattie Justus married Nov. 21, 1908, in Madison Co., Alabama. Their first child was James L. Gibson, born in 1909. Marie was their child. Hattie was daughter of Isaac W. Justus or Justice from Henderson Co., North Carolina. Sources: Marriage record, Vol. 34, p. 16. Census, 1910, Madison Co., Alabama, e.d. 145, Sh. 18 A. GIBSON, P. S. , APR. 1, 1861 - MAR. 15, 1906. (ROW 11) P. S. Gibson married Myrtle Gaines in Madison Co. Alabama c Jan. 26, 1906. Source: Marriage record, Vol. 31, p. 193. GLENN, JOE T., SEPT. 26, 1893 - FEB. 3, 1904, SON OF W. F. AND B. E. GLENN. STONE BROKEN TO THE GROUND IN 1997. (ROW 5) Joe T. Glenn, son of William F. and Beatrice E. Glenn were living in Walker Co., Georgia in 1900, in a mining district. The father, William was born in Jan. 1850, Beatrice was born in June of I860. Both of them and all their children were born in Alabama. The children were William E., born 1881, Henry, born 1883, Walter W., born 1886, Nettie L., born 1887, Maggie May, born 1890, Joseph T., born Sept. 1893, and Keener K., born 1896. Joe died in Merrimack in 1904, but the family did not stay here long after that. His brother Walter was back in Walker Co., Georgia in 1910. He had recently taken a wife, Lillie, and they were parents of Theo, then 7 months old. Lillie was born in Georgia and Walter was born in Alabama. Walter was a weaver in a cotton mill in Linwood, Georgia. Compiler did not find William F. or Beatrice in Georgia in 1910, nor any of Joe's other brothers. Sources: Census, 1900, Walker Co., Georgia,E.D. 96, Sh. 4 A, line 11, Wilson District. Census, 1910, Walker Co., Georgia, E.D. 141, Sh. 4 A, line 3, Linwood town. 45 - (1351)
